Sediment source and dose influence the larval performance of the threatened coral <i>Orbicella faveolata</i>
2023-09-26
Abstract excerpt
The effects of turbidity and sedimentation stress on early life stages of corals are poorly understood, particularly in Atlantic species. Dredging operations, beach nourishment, and other coastal construction activities can increase sedimentation and turbidity in nearby coral reef habitats and have the potential to negatively affect coral larval development and metamorphosis, reducing sexual reproduction success....
